The accumulation distribution (A/D) indicator shows the degree to which Scope Metals is accumulated by the market over a given period. It uses the quote sensitivity to the highest or lowest daily price of Scope Metals Group to determine if accumulation or reduction is taking place in the market. This value is adjusted by Scope Metals trading volume to give more weight to distributions with higher volume over lower volume.

Accumulation distribution indicator can signal that a trend is either nearing completion, at a continuation, or is about to break-outs. The actual value of this indicator is of no significance. What is significant is the change in value of over time. The formula for A/D of a given trading day can be expressed as follow: ((Close - Low) - (High - Close)) / (High - Low) X Volume
